12 yellow balls and 9 red balls are placed in an urn. Two balls are then drawn in succession without replacement. What is the pr
denis23 [38]

Answer:

\frac{9}{35}

Step-by-step explanation:

When the first draw is done there are 9 red balls in a sample size of 21. So there probability of drawing a red ball will be \frac{9}{21}

When the second draw is done, there will be 12 yellow balls in a sample size of 20 since the first ball will not have been replaced into the bag. So the chance of someone drawing the second ball in the second draw is \frac{12}{20}

The probability of them happening in this order is the product of both probabilities:

\frac{9}{21}  * \frac{12}{20}  = \frac{9}{35}
